Tourist Attractions in Johannesburg

Planning a trip to Johannesburg, or more commonly known as ‘Jozi’, may feel a little overwhelming for a first-timer. Other than being the biggest city in South Africa, it also has a bad reputation for being the most dangerous.

Joburg-Night

If you’re travelling around Joburg, you certainly need to be alert. Having said that; when it comes down to Johannesburg tourist attractions, it has so much to offer – a rich history, dynamic culture and vibrant atmosphere. It hosts a number of the most renowned historical places in South Africa and has a magical buzz that will leave you wanting to come back for more.

Places to To visit in Johannesburg

Jozi offers a variety of suburbs, landmarks and surrounding areas that are worth seeing – each unique in their own way. The inner city, usually avoided by tourists, is transforming into an oasis of trends and creativity. It is also home to the Market Theatre, vibey Braamfontein, as well as the artsy Maboneng.

Maboneng

Visitors are mostly drawn to the leafy suburbs in the north of Joburg. Areas like Norwood and Parktown are buzzing with trendy restaurants and bars. The chic streets of Greenside also offer a buzzing nightlife.

For the more alternative crowds, edgy Melville is an all time favourite. And don’t forget all the fancy malls of Sandton for splashing out on some fashionable items.

Joburg knows how to show it’s visitors that the big city life is the way to go!

Things to Do in Johannesburg

Now that you know what places visit, the next logical step would be to plan how you are going to experience the true essence of Jozi. Below is a short breakdown of some of the most exciting things to do in Johannesburg:

  • For history-lovers, The Apartheids Museum is a must-see as it illustrates the rise and fall of South Africa’s prejudiced system that led to racial segregation.
  • In the mood for some Johannesburg sightseeing? Then hop on the open air Red Bus, a Johannesburg tour bus that explore sites like Carlton Centre, James Hall Museum and the famous Nelson Mandela Bridge.
  • Get your blood pumping on a rollercoaster ride at Gold Reef City. For a more cultural experience, grab a bike and take a guided tour through Soweto.
  • There are a number of lush green parks and nature reserves to go for the outdoorsy travelers, such as the Walter Sisulu National Botanical Garden and Emmarentia Dam.
  • The Magaliesberg is just an hour drive from Joburg for those needing to breakaway from the city. One of the oldest mountain ranges on earth, it is a perfect destination for weekend getaways, hikes and camping trips.
  • The Kruger National Park is a must see for nature lovers! Known as the home of Big 5, here you can experience African wildlife at its best. From guided safaris, variety of accomodation to adventurous activities in surrounding areas, this will truly be a trip of a lifetime!
